Hey everyone,
Could there be a feature that allows users to select multiple files directly from either the content viewer or may be the search results and perform some action on the selected files like 'deletion' , 'move to...' , 'change assignment...' or may be even 'change status'.
Basically a batch processing of documents.

I second that! I am trialling LetoDMS for our small Charity, which is evaluating it for use on its web server, as an offsite document repository for disaster recovery, as well as a collaborative DMS for the Trustees and Staff. The Charity has a tiny budget and couldn't afford a commercial product, but I believe I could persuade them to donate to LetoDMS, if the system can demonstrate it does what we need it to.
The problems we are having are:
uploading the whole of the electronic archives was a mountain of work, a job that FTP would have greatly simplified
all files are now in limbo, waiting for approval that will never come, being mostly archive, but nevertheless essential files
had to turn off notifications, because the mailboxes of all three Reviewers were getting a constant stream of messages
any new files uploaded are now lost in the sea of "Pending, Unapproved" files.
Two features I think would bring LetoDMS into the realm of a fully-fledged DMS system:
one of them requested by Max, here: batch processing of files
The other FTP up/download
Batch processing could be as simple as a tick box for each file (with options for "Select All" / "Deselect All") and a pull-down menu of Actions "on selected files"
Another might be a filtering system, with options for using wildcards.
